Steps to reproduce: Click on Help -> About SeaMonkey from the menu. What happens: A new browser window is opened with "about:" as its contents. What should happen: ddAssuming that the current view shouldn't be replaced (as if you'd entered "about:" as a new URL), then a new browser *tab* (not window) should be opened. If I've set "A new tab in the current window" as my browser preference for all links, the menu item should not be disregarding it.ruoy
